Ticket #4471 — Config drift on MergeWell dedupe workers

The customer-record deduplication service (MergeWell) is running with different fuzzy-match thresholds across the three worker pools. Pool B was hand-edited during the Falkner Retail incident and never reverted, so duplicate merges are being flagged inconsistently depending on which pool picks up the job. Support should not re-run merges until the pools are aligned. For reference while triaging, the values currently active on Pool B are as follows.

settings of tagef-bawif:
DRUIX_HOST=druix.zemvarlabs.internal
DRUIX_PORT=8000

## Authentication

Heads up: the nightly reindex job (`reindex_nightly.py`) talks to the Lanternfish search cluster, and that cluster won't accept anonymous writes anymore — we locked it down last sprint. The job now authenticates as the `reindex-runner` service identity against Corvid Gateway, and the token is injected via the `LF_INDEX_TOKEN` env var in the scheduler config. Nothing clever going on, just a bearer header on every batch request. For review purposes, the staging credential currently in use is listed below.

service key, kadug-kadup: kto15_rN23XLAYImmZgrJ

Subject: DR drill Thursday — admin table bulk edits

Team, Thursday's disaster-recovery drill for Hollyvale will simulate a botched bulk edit in the Ledgerpane admin table. We'll intentionally mass-update 4,000 rows, then practice restoring from the change journal. New folks: your job is to follow the rollback runbook, not improvise. The restore tool prompts for the DR vault passphrase before it will replay the journal; for the drill, use the one printed below this message.

strongbox words: zordor-quenax

Ticket: Staging env misconfigured for Siftgate bloom filter

The bloom layer in front of the Pellet KV store is rejecting all lookups in staging because the env file was copied from the dev template without credentials. False-positive tuning values are fine; only the auth line is missing. To unblock the weekly demo, the Pellet admission secret must be set on the following line.

env line for yaguf-fajop: LEDGER_TOKEN13=fb08984397349